logo

Output e1304126063880e20bcacec215f281e9b6b66e6fd411ad0ac8139c69d1f8dd02:2

value
3580895
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27954cdb1fae73f758f71e2945baba265743f700 OP_EQUALVERIFY OP_CHECKSIG
address
14cJD3TkAUNu8gBZGDjicgoarH83r1hVLn
transaction
e1304126063880e20bcacec215f281e9b6b66e6fd411ad0ac8139c69d1f8dd02